// POST api/competence public void Post(UserCompetenceUpdateModel updateModel) { var repo = new UserCompetenceRepository(); var entity = repo.Get(updateModel.UserId); var command = new CompetenceUpdateCommand { CompentenceText = updateModel.CompetenceText }; entity.UpdateCompentence(command); }
// GET api/competence/{id} public UserCompetenceGetModel Get(string id) { var repo = new UserCompetenceRepository(); var entity = repo.Get(id); return(new UserCompetenceGetModel { CompetenceText = entity.CompetenceText, Competencies = entity.CompetenceList }); }